Abstract: Modeling and finite element analysis functions were combined in Solid Edge to optimize gear parameters. Gear parameters optimization objective and procedure in different conditions were summed up. A complete Excel file was created. An involute gear parametric model was established which was interlinking with the Excel file. And the model’s accuracy would not alter with the diameter’s change. The wizard software for gear drive design and parameter optimization was developed on platform of Solid Edge by Visual Basic tool. This application can guide users getting the initial parameters and optimizing the parameters by the circling method of diminishing parameters, analyzing the precise gear root stress with Femap Express module, and diminishing them again. Users can get a gear model which has a smaller diameter and smaller module and satisfies strength demands.

Abstract: A static-stability calculation method for ships which use the second-development of Solid Edge is presented in this paper. The second-development of Solid Edge applied Visual Basic to divide the waterplane and measure the parameters concerned static-stability calculation such as the volume and center of the underwater model. Furturemore, it makes the statics-stability calculation be convenient that the paragraph of static-stability is calculated on the parameters and the dismiss angle is returned. According to the comparison of the experiments and the theory, including different forms of superstructure models, it can be proved that this method is reliable and effective in the static-stability calculation for ships.

Abstract: In order to improve the design efficiency of the crane and its parts to meet the fierce market competition, we developed rapid design system for crane drum. According to GMD theory, this paper takes crane drum for study, and divides it into several modules to form series and modular of crane drum. Summarized the design theory and knowledge of the crane drum and determined the parameters of functional modules. We shift modules from static modules to dynamic modules. By making a second development of Solid Edge with Visual Basic.NET, we developed agile design system for crane drum. After numerous tests in the actual design process, the system can greatly improved the quality and efficiency of design.
